Output 340f268e7fab2c75333adeaeff633b6bc149bbf902d18e997543f52f552261d4:1

value
6201605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9b79c1c5d297c9435ea04d17d42c6c886e650d0 OP_EQUAL
address
3L5bhXyD65JajDb39wQPM2FiuWmFqg2NqB
transaction
340f268e7fab2c75333adeaeff633b6bc149bbf902d18e997543f52f552261d4
spent
true